      Hello. I am restoring a 1977ish  1/24th scale ‘Heritage’ fishing boat kit. Can anyone suggest a  way of replicating fishing nets at that scale.

      The kit had hair nets which looked quite good but ‘hair net technology’ has moved on and the modern Asda version just looks like,well, hair!.

          there is a company with a shop in Fleetwood Called Fleetwood Trawler Supply who trade in the shop as "The Yacht Shop", 1 Station Road Fleetwood, FY7 6NW, Tel: 01253 879238 and if you search on the net for http://www.ybw.com they sell proper Shrimp fishing net.

          It has a mesh of about 3/16 to a 1/4 inch guage and is tar impregnated for long lasting, and is properly tied from hemp.( not moulded plastic)

          It is so fine because of the nature that it is used, but nowadays with little shrimping going on in the old traditional way in Morecambe Bay they sell it in a packet with old shells and sometimes a plastic crab or Star fish for ornamentation.

          But it is the real macoy and I use it on my model trawlers at 1:32 scale.Even smells right being tar impregnated.

          The last time I bought a bag of it ( about 2 metres square) it was £3.75 a bag.

          Hope this helps, neil.

          Forgot to add, it comes in a deep brown colour similar to what "old" fishing nets came in, not the more modern synthetic greens and oranges.

                      I found a suitable material for 1:24 – 1:32 scale fishing boat nets.

                      It’s called tulle, is available ready-coloured in most colours needed such as green, blue, orange etc and (I think!) is made from nylon.

                      I ordered a small piece (100cm x 137cm) from a seller on ebay that I can highly recommend. It cost 99p +55p postage and was delivered within 2 days of ordering.
